’The Bad Guys 2’ Opens with Thrilling Animation and Ensemble Cast as Critics Point to Overstretched Plot

Reviewers praise the sequel’s inventive animation in a globe-spanning heist that probes challenges of redemption through its reformed criminal protagonists.

Overview

  • The Bad Guys 2 opened in theaters on July 25 ahead of its official August 1 debut.
  • Directed by Pierre Perifel and JP Sans, the sequel employs a hybrid “3D-made-to-look-like-2D” animation style with anime influences.
  • Sam Rockwell, Marc Maron, Craig Robinson, Anthony Ramos and Awkwafina lead a star-studded voice cast praised for elevating the film’s comedic heist.
  • The narrative carries the reformed Bad Guys crew from a high-speed Cairo flashback through Mexican wrestling matches to an elaborate outer-space climax powered by a hijacked rocket.
  • Some critics warn that the film’s ambitious scope and its deeper focus on recidivism occasionally strain its narrative coherence.
